Mind Chapters is a unique, story-based wellbeing programme, designed to support children’s emotional understanding, resilience, and self-awareness through narrative, reflection, and guided conversation.

Our original Mind Chapters stories explore emotional experiences in relatable and engaging ways, creating a safe and inclusive space where children can recognise feelings, reflect on challenges, and connect with characters’ experiences. Within each story world, children practise noticing thoughts, managing emotions, and experimenting with practical strategies:  building confidence before applying these skills in real-life situations.

Each story in the Mind Chapters coaching programme is carefully crafted for use within one-to-one wellbeing sessions, combining emotional exploration with accessible tools that help children develop emotional literacy in a way that feels natural, creative, and supportive. 

Alongside our story-based one-to-one coaching sessions, where stories form the heart of the emotional exploration, we also offer story-led workshops, group sessions, creative wellbeing activities for schools and community settings and a children's book series.

Our book series brings Mind Chapters stories into homes and classrooms. Each book invites children into imaginative narratives and includes peer reflections from the children in the coaching workbook, helping young readers pause, notice, and think about feelings and thoughts. These stories support emotional awareness, reflection, and practical engagement in a way that complements the work done in coaching sessions.

We also empower children to write, illustrate, and share their own wellbeing stories — stories for kids, by kids — encouraging self-expression, empathy, and a lifelong love of reading and writing. Through our children’s publishing projects and Mind Chapters storybooks, we provide resources that support wellbeing and self-awareness both at home and in the classroom.

From one-to-one coaching and school-based sessions to community workshops and publishing projects, everything we do is rooted in the belief that stories help children make sense of their inner worlds and that when children feel understood, they are better equipped to thrive.

6. Mind Chapters Champions Programme (Schools)

Within the Mind Chapters story world, children are introduced to a set of characters who appear at the beginning of each book. These characters gently guide children through different wellbeing themes, helping them explore emotions, thoughts, friendships, and everyday challenges in ways that feel relatable and safe. Building on this storytelling approach, we also offer the Mind Chapters Champions Programme for schools. This programme invites selected pupils to become Mind Chapters Champions - young wellbeing ambassadors who help promote kindness, emotional awareness, and supportive friendships within their school community. With age-appropriate training and guidance from Mind Chapters facilitators, Champions learn simple ways to:

  • Encourage kindness, empathy, and respectful communication

  • Help create a positive and inclusive school culture

  • Support peers by promoting wellbeing conversations and activities

  • Model healthy ways of noticing and talking about feelings

 

Mind Chapters Champions are not expected to take on adult roles or provide counselling. Instead, they act as positive role models, helping to encourage small everyday actions that contribute to a kinder, more emotionally aware environment in school.

The programme includes:

  • Wellbeing champion training sessions

  • Story-based activities linked to Mind Chapters characters

  • Champion-led kindness and wellbeing initiatives within school

  • Ongoing support and guidance for staff facilitating the programme

 

Through the Champions Programme, children not only learn about wellbeing through stories — they also experience what it means to actively contribute to a supportive and caring school community.
